Description The experience of individual members of the security forces and the discussion of the professional public reveal a hitherto sufficiently unexplained issue of the influence of alcohol on self-defense performance. The real effect of alcohol on the ability of a defender intoxicated with 1.1 alcohol to defend itself against the literature has not been satisfactorily described. The purpose of the investigation is to determine the effect of 1.1 breath alcohol on the reaction time and survival of a person who is attacked by an attacker using a knife.
